feminine · Dutch origin
Annet is a Dutch diminutive form of Anna, which itself derives from the Hebrew name Channah, meaning grace or favor. It developed as a familiar pet form in the Low Countries alongside similar short forms used across Western Europe. The name also sees independent use in Uganda and other parts of East Africa, where it was adopted through Christian missionary influence. Related forms include Anna, Anne, Annette, and Anita.
